The Growing Influence Of Nordic Additive Manufacturing

nordic additive manufacturing, also known as 3D printing, is a rapidly growing industry that has been making a significant impact on various sectors, including healthcare, aerospace, automotive, and more. The Nordic countries – Denmark, Finland, Iceland, Norway, and Sweden – have all been actively involved in the development and advancement of additive manufacturing technologies, leading to the emergence of cutting-edge innovations and solutions.

One of the key drivers behind the rise of nordic additive manufacturing is the region’s strong commitment to research and development. Universities and research institutions in the Nordic countries have been at the forefront of conducting research on additive manufacturing technologies, exploring new materials, processes, and applications. This focus on innovation and collaboration has enabled the Nordic region to establish itself as a hub for additive manufacturing expertise.

In recent years, nordic additive manufacturing has gained traction in the healthcare sector, with 3D printing being used to create patient-specific implants, prosthetics, and surgical tools. Additive manufacturing technologies offer healthcare professionals the ability to produce customized and complex structures that are tailored to individual patients, leading to improved patient outcomes and reduced surgery times. The region’s expertise in healthcare and technology has positioned Nordic countries as leaders in the field of medical 3D printing.

Furthermore, the aerospace and automotive industries in the Nordic region have also embraced additive manufacturing technologies to enhance their manufacturing processes and develop lightweight, high-performance components. Additive manufacturing enables designers and engineers to create intricate geometries and complex structures that would be impossible to produce using traditional manufacturing methods. This has led to significant advancements in the performance and efficiency of aerospace and automotive components, driving innovation and competitiveness in these industries.

Another notable area where Nordic additive manufacturing is making strides is in sustainability and environmental conservation. Additive manufacturing technologies have the potential to reduce material waste and energy consumption during the manufacturing process, leading to a more sustainable and eco-friendly production method. By using 3D printing to produce parts on-demand and locally, companies can minimize their carbon footprint and reduce transportation costs, contributing to a more sustainable supply chain.

The Nordic region’s expertise in additive manufacturing has also attracted the attention of international companies and investors looking to collaborate with Nordic partners and leverage their additive manufacturing capabilities. This has led to the establishment of partnerships and collaborations between Nordic companies and global players, fostering knowledge exchange and innovation in the field of additive manufacturing.

Moreover, the Nordic countries have been active in promoting additive manufacturing education and training programs to build a skilled workforce capable of driving innovation and growth in the industry. Universities and technical schools in the region offer specialized courses and degrees in additive manufacturing, providing students with the knowledge and skills needed to excel in this rapidly evolving field. This investment in education and training will help ensure that the Nordic region remains at the forefront of additive manufacturing advancements and continues to attract top talent and investment.
